- [ ] **Step 7: Breaker override escrow.** After sealing the signing keys for the Tallgrove upstream API circuit breaker, confirm the support team can force the breaker open during a full outage. The override bundle lives in the sealed escrow drawer and is useless without its unlock phrase. Two ceremony witnesses must initial this step before proceeding. The escrow bundle is decrypted with the recovery passphrase that follows.

vault phrase of kahip-kahop = holath-quenmir

## Recovery: Gatewright Rate Limiter Lockout

Maintainers: if the Gatewright internal API gateway lockout logic disables the admin account (usually after a misconfigured limit loops on itself), do not reset limits via the data plane — state will desync. Instead, use the offline recovery shell on the control node. It prompts once; three failures wipe the session. At the prompt, supply the recovery passphrase shown below.

vault phrase of tahop-kagag = ralok-lamvan-gilok-ralmir-fraion

Ticket: Staging env misconfigured for Siftgate bloom filter

The bloom layer in front of the Pellet KV store is rejecting all lookups in staging because the env file was copied from the dev template without credentials. False-positive tuning values are fine; only the auth line is missing. To unblock the weekly demo, the Pellet admission secret must be set on the following line.

env line for yaguf-fajop: LEDGER_TOKEN13=fb08984397349

## 3.2.0 — Changed defaults

The Kestrelgate internal API gateway now enforces stricter default rate limits on plugin-registered routes. Burst allowances were halved and the sliding window shortened to ten seconds. Plugins relying on the old defaults should declare explicit limits in their manifest. For reference, the new gateway defaults shipping with this release are as follows.

service settings:
[casax]
port = 6379
team = rusir
host = casax.zemvarhq.corp
region = outer-4
access_code = ac_9808ce
timeout_ms = 1500